Expert: Trump has no final plan – could end in disappointment for many

Not even Donald Trump himself knows what his final plan for Iran is. This is what Jan Hallenberg, US expert and associate senior researcher at the Swedish Institute for International Affairs, tells TT.

Hallenberg believes that the US will continue bombing for a few weeks, after which Trump will declare victory, withdraw his forces and leave a bombed-out Iran and the Middle East to their fate.

The whole thing risks ultimately ending in disappointment for many, according to Hallenberg.

– Trump will be able to say that he has weakened the regime, that the Ayatollah is dead and a number of other military leaders are dead. But he will hardly be able to say that the regime has fallen.


Analysis: Trump's dilemma is how long the war should last

Donald Trump's dilemma now is whether to declare victory in Iran or escalate the war, writes Dominic Waghorn for Sky News.

"He says it could last for weeks - is he serious and can the US hold out for that long?"

Warnings have been leaked from the Pentagon that the US force in the region has enough resources for a week or two of warfare, and Gulf states are already reportedly asking Trump to call an end because their stock of anti-aircraft missiles is running out quickly, according to Waghorn.

The fact that the US and Israel have superior weapons does not make wars of attrition easy, write Amos C Fox and Franz-Stefan Gady in Foreign Policy.

"In short, running out of ammunition is always a problem."

This applies especially to the advanced, guided weapons that the US and Israel use - production is too expensive and slow, they continue.

The Trump administration has clearly shown that they have interests rather than friends, writes SVT's Carl Fridh Kleberg.

"If it benefits the US, an agreement can be reached without any problems with the regime, regardless of its ideology or actions."

Trump's plan for regime change is a joke - who is he urging the Iranians to hand over power to? wonders Aftonbladet's Niclas Vent.

"Neither the US nor Israel will deploy ground troops, and there is no alternative source of armed authority in Iran other than the regime."
